Let $h: (0,1) \times (0,1)->\mathbb{R}$ be a differentiable function, and let $S=\{(u,v,h(u,v))| u,v \in (0,1)\}$. Determine the differentiable functions $h$ for which the area of $S$ is $1$.

We know that the area of $S$ is $\int_{(0,1) \times (0,1)} ((\dfrac{\partial h}{\partial u})^2+(\dfrac{\partial h}{\partial v})^2+1)^ \frac{1}{2} dudv$ but know how can i resolve the problem?
